Cabin Engineer Lead

Selectek has partnered with a growing aviation client in the Indianapolis, IN Metro area that is looking for a Cabin Engineer Lead to design and analyze aircraft cabin interior systems components needed to support Aircraft interior modifications.

Performs a variety of aircraft cabin/interiors engineering work including drawing interpretation, design and substantiation as related to transport category aircraft cabin interior modifications.

What you will be responsible for:

  • Research new technology (material and manufacturing processes) for use in seating and interior products for the development of new lightweight and cost-efficient products.
  • Design and analyze aircraft cabin interior systems and components, typically in support of aircraft interior modifications (STC projects) including integration of seats, monuments, PSUs, flooring, emergency equipment, sidewall/dado/ceiling panels, windows, stowage bins and placards.
  • Work independently to gather data and input on the development of original designs or adaptations of existing designs after having been given general instructions regarding scope and parameters.
  • Coordinate and monitor cabin interiors aspects of project schedule with project managers and cabin engineers.
  • Prepare cabin interior modification/installation/fabrication drawings, engineering reports and work instructions. Support cabin engineers with assignments and skills development as needed.
  • Participate in design reviews and presentations with suppliers, customers, and various internal departments to obtain input on, agreement with, and understanding of project objectives and schedules.
  • Troubleshoot aircraft issues during STC prototype and post STC using standard testing tools and methods.
  • Travel both domestically and internationally (up to 10%).

Required:

  • 5+ years of engineering design or analysis experience.
  • Experience with commercial aircraft (Airbus or Boeing).
  • Familiarity with Federal Aviation Regulations (FARs - from Title 14 of the Code of Federal Regulations) as they apply to transport category aircraft.
  • Familiarity with the FAA Supplemental Type Certificate (STC) process.
  • Ability to read and interpret technical drawings and technical publications (i.e.:
    Structural Repair Manual (SRM), Aircraft Maintenance Manual (AMM), Illustrated Parts Catalog (IPC).
  • Experience creating engineering details, assemblies and installation drawings using AutoCAD/Inventor, Solid Works or other standard engineering drawing convention.

Preferred:

  • Bachelor's Degree in Aerospace, Aeronautical or Mechanical Engineering or equivalent.
